Overview: hotel description: Break Sokos Hotel Levi description

The stylish Sokos Hotel is a great choice if you like a touch of luxury on your ski break. It’s made up of three buildings, with rooms themed around the seasons – bright summer, warm autumn, or cool winter. Elements of Finnish nature, from flora to fauna, are represented in the cosy furnishings and chic artwork.

There’s a room to suit everyone at the Sokos – though it’s definitely worth upgrading to a superior room to get your own private sauna. If you like a little more space, the suites have a separate bedroom and living room too.

The Sokos is offered on a bed & breakfast basis, but you can upgrade to half board if you like. The Kiisa Restaurant also offers an à la carte menu with authentic Finnish specialities including reindeer steak, or you can pop into the Coffee House for lunch or afternoon snack.

And what better way to warm up after a day out on the slopes than sitting back in the hotel’s own sauna or hot tub – perfect for soothing sore muscles. If you’ve got the kids in tow, the playroom is ideal for keeping them entertained.

The hotel is situated right in the resort centre, with several shops and restaurants on your doorstep. It’s also really close to the lifts and ski school, so you don't have to worry about lugging your gear for miles.

Room Types: Break Sokos Hotel Levi bedrooms

All rooms are non-smoking and have a flatscreen TV with UK channel, free WiFi, telephone, hairdryer, safe, tea and coffee facilities and minibar. Superior rooms and suites also have bathrobes and slippers. Balconies can be requested but cannot be guaranteed.

Twin room - sleeps 2-3: Twin beds, extra rollaway bed when booked for three people, private shower and WC.

Superior twin room - sleeps 2: Twin beds, private shower, WC and sauna.

Suite - sleeps 2-4 (max 3 adults or 2 adults and 2 children up to 15 years): Twin beds, living room with double sofa bed, private shower, WC and sauna.

Family room - sleeps 4-5: Interconnecting twin and superior twin rooms.

Etelärinteet is the name of the area to the south, Itärinteet is its eastern ridge, and there’s north-facing Koillisrinteet. Eturinteet is where you’ll find the front pistes, and the snowparks and Gondoli World Cup run are also on the west ridge. Lastenmaa Kids’ Land by Zero Point and Tenavatokka is the perfect place to learn; there’s a fantastic wide run amongst the trees.
